12 Things Your Hair Can Tell You About Your Health

Photo by Koy Jang from Shutterstock

Dry hair

Hormonal imbalances can have an impact on your hair’s health. As an example, a change in birth control medication may release a new level of hormones your body isn’t used to, which can lead to changes in your hair texture as well. You can actually tell if you’re on new birth control pills because it makes your hair finer, drier, and less shiny.

Every individual that is going through some hormonal changes can experience this: puberty, menopause, pregnancy, all these are at fault for your hair’s health. Increased stress hormones can mess up your hair’s life cycle, leading to longer periods in the shedding phase.
